The second season of Virgin River was an emotional roller coaster for Hope and Doc Mullins. Hope ended up having a mild heart attack, which changed her outlook on life and she was afraid of death.

Doc was confused as to why he wanted a divorce after so long and admitted that the heart attack had made him consider how he would spend the rest of his life at Virgin River.

The couple ended up fighting again over the divorce plans, but eventually, Doc presented Hope with the Virgin River divorce papers and told her that all she had to do was sign them.

Towards the end of the season, Doc had Hope’s engagement ring reset and presented it to her, proposing a second time. Plans for the wedding reception were in full swing at Virgin River when Hope wanted to say something to Doc.

Hope asked him if he’d gone for a checkup and he put his hand on her arm. She said Doc was starting to scare her, but before she had time to explain herself, the door to her house slammed open and a group of Virgin River residents appeared.

Both Hope and Doc looked puzzled, but they managed to put on a brave face for their guests, and Virgin River fans have been wondering what Doc was about to say.

The most obvious Virgin River theory is that he has been diagnosed with some kind of disease or condition, which would leave his colleague Mel Monroe (Alexandra Breckenridge) directing the surgery full time.

There is a suggestion that Doc being told at his appointment will have a huge impact on his ability to work as a primary physician. There’s a chance he could hand over his surgery to Mel, which would be a huge step in the Virgin River star’s career.
